摘要
研究生教育,特别是工程类研究生教育的类型应更加多样化,应呈现多层次的培养模式,以满足不同的社会需要并与国外研究生培养模式的发展趋势相适应。通过加强学科建设、促进学科间的交叉渗透等措施来提高工科研究生的培养水平是可行的。对于像岩土工程专业这样的传统学科,通过吸收高新技术成果,加强交叉学科的建设完全可以培养出创新性的高水平人才。
Graduate education, especially the engineering graduate education, should adopt the more diversified cultivation modes of different levels in present phase, in order to satisfy the needs of society and follow the tendency of world development. It is advisable to advance the cultivation level of engineering graduate by strengthening discipline construction and promoting the intersec- tion between different disciplines. Besides, for some traditional disciplines such as geotechnical engineering, it is possible to cultivate high-level personnel by the development of high technology and the construction of cross-discipline.
